Installazione · 2 min read · Oct 27, 2025
La Configurazione Perfetta - Debian Etch (Debian 4.0) - Pagina 3
4 Installa Il Server SSH
Debian Etch non installa OpenSSH per impostazione predefinita, quindi lo facciamo ora. Esegui
apt-get install ssh openssh-serverTi verrà chiesto di inserire di nuovo il CD di installazione.
5 Configura La Rete
Poiché l’installer di Debian Etch ha configurato il nostro sistema per ottenere le impostazioni di rete tramite DHCP, dobbiamo cambiare questo ora perché un server dovrebbe avere un indirizzo IP statico. Modifica /etc/network/interfaces e adattalo alle tue esigenze (in questo esempio utilizzerò l’indirizzo IP 192.168.0.100) (si prega di notare che sostituisco allow-hotplug eth0 con auto eth0; altrimenti il riavvio della rete non funziona e dovremmo riavviare l’intero sistema):
vi /etc/network/interfaces| # Questo file descrive le interfacce di rete disponibili sul tuo sistema # e come attivarle. Per ulteriori informazioni, vedere interfaces(5). # L'interfaccia di rete di loopback auto lo iface lo inet loopback # L'interfaccia di rete principale #allow-hotplug eth0 #iface eth0 inet dhcp auto eth0 iface eth0 inet static address 192.168.0.100 netmask 255.255.255.0 network 192.168.0.0 broadcast 192.168.0.255 gateway 192.168.0.1 |
Poi riavvia la tua rete:
/etc/init.d/networking restartPoi modifica /etc/hosts. Fai in modo che appaia così:
vi /etc/hosts| 127.0.0.1 localhost.localdomain localhost 192.168.0.100 server1.example.com server1 # Le seguenti righe sono desiderabili per gli host compatibili con IPv6 ::1 ip6-localhost ip6-loopback fe00::0 ip6-localnet ff00::0 ip6-mcastprefix ff02::1 ip6-allnodes ff02::2 ip6-allrouters ff02::3 ip6-allhosts |
Ora esegui
echo server1.example.com > /etc/hostnamee riavvia il sistema:
shutdown -r nowDopo, esegui
hostname
hostname -f
Entrambi dovrebbero mostrare server1.example.com.
Da ora in poi puoi utilizzare un client SSH come PuTTY e connetterti dal tuo workstation al tuo server Debian Etch e seguire i restanti passaggi di questo tutorial.
6
Modifica /etc/apt/sources.list E Aggiorna La Tua Installazione Di Linux
Modifica /etc/apt/sources.list. Commenta il CD. Dovrebbe apparire così:
vi /etc/apt/sources.list| # # deb cdrom:[Debian GNU/Linux 4.0 r0 _Etch_ - Official i386 NETINST Binary-1 20070407-11:29]/ etch contrib main #deb cdrom:[Debian GNU/Linux 4.0 r0 _Etch_ - Official i386 NETINST Binary-1 20070407-11:29]/ etch contrib main deb http://ftp2.de.debian.org/debian/ etch main deb-src http://ftp2.de.debian.org/debian/ etch main deb http://security.debian.org/ etch/updates main contrib deb-src http://security.debian.org/ etch/updates main contrib |
Poi esegui
apt-get updateper aggiornare il database dei pacchetti apt e
apt-get upgradeper installare gli ultimi aggiornamenti (se ce ne sono).
7 Installa Alcuni Software
Ora installiamo alcuni pacchetti necessari in seguito. Esegui
apt-get install binutils cpp fetchmail flex gcc libarchive-zip-perl libc6-dev libcompress-zlib-perl libdb4.3-dev libpcre3 libpopt-dev linux-kernel-headers lynx m4 make ncftp nmap openssl perl perl-modules unzip zip zlib1g-dev autoconf automake1.9 libtool bison autotools-dev g++(Questo comando dovrebbe andare in un’unica riga!)
8 Quota
(Se hai scelto uno schema di partizionamento diverso dal mio, devi adattare questo capitolo affinché la quota si applichi alle partizioni dove ne hai bisogno.)
Per installare la quota, esegui
apt-get install quotaModifica /etc/fstab. Il mio appare così (ho aggiunto,usrquota,grpquota alla partizione /dev/sda1 (punto di montaggio /; il tuo nome dispositivo potrebbe essere /dev/hda1 o simile)):
vi /etc/fstab| # /etc/fstab: informazioni statiche sul file system. # # |
Per abilitare la quota, esegui questi comandi:
touch /quota.user /quota.group
chmod 600 /quota.*
mount -o remount /
quotacheck -avugm
quotaon -avug
Ricevi i nuovi post nella tua casella di posta.
Nessuno spam. Disiscriviti in qualsiasi momento.